Role Description

This is a full-time, on-site position based in Houston, TX for an Order Fulfillment Associate. In this role, you will be responsible for preparing, packaging, and processing orders for shipment. With a high daily volume of incoming orders, we’re seeking someone who can handle tasks efficiently while maintaining strong attention to accuracy.

Things we're looking for - You don't need to have all qualifications.
β€’ Strong attention to detail to ensure accurate order fulfillment.
β€’ Ability to stay organized while handling hundreds of orders throughout the day.
β€’ Basic familiarity with trading cards and other collectibles is a plus.
β€’ Previous experience with Live Commerce streaming sales or online retail is a plus
β€’ Ability to quickly learn and adapt.

Pay starts at $15/hour with room to grow to much more.
